Conclusion Meanings:

'Exonerated': or 'Within NYPD Guidelines' - the alleged conduct occurred but did not violate the NYPD's own rules, which often give officers significant discretion.
'Unsubstantiated': or 'Unable to Determine' - CCRB has fully investigated but could not affirmatively conclude both that the conduct occurred and that it broke the rules.

Discipline

Case: 2010-3112
Closed: 11/10/2010
Case Details:
  1. Pleaded Guilty: Fail and neglect to prepare a stop, question and frisk report worksheet (pd344-151a) documenting his questioning of a person, known to the Department.
  2. Pleaded Guilty: Did incorrectly enter the name and date of birth of a person known to the Department, on a criminal court summons.
  3. Pleaded Guilty: Did fail to have marijuana, recovered during an arrest, field tested, resulting in the dismissal of a criminal court summons.
  4. Pleaded Guilty: Did fail to perform a warrant check prior to releasing a person, known to the Department.
  5. Pleaded Guilty: Did fail and neglect to make proper entries in memo book.
  6. Pleaded Guilty: Did inform another member of the service that he had issued a summons to an Internal Affairs Bureau confidential informant.
Penalty: Vacation days (15 days)


Lawsuits

Greenidge, Osei vs City of New York, et al.
Case # 19CV03710, U.S. District Court - Eastern District NY, July 15, 2019, ended February 14, 2020
$12,500 Settlement
Complaint
Description: On August 16th, 2018 Plaintiff Greenidge was arrested by Defendant Officers Kinkaid, Morales, and Russo. Prior to supplying bail, Defendant Officers assured Plaintiff Greenidge that they would be released upon the provision of bail. Defendant Kinkaid delayed Greenidge's release due to an NYPD I-Card. Plaintiff was released on August 21, 2018. While in custody, Defendants refused to provide Plaintiff with the treatment and medications requested.
